I was wondering what is the best way to convert a boolean value retrieved from the database to text for use in a display-field or textbox (e.g. true or false to Male or Female). Any suggestions?
Share
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.
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.
Lost your password? Please enter your email address. You will receive a link and will create a new password via email.
Please briefly explain why you feel this question should be reported.
Please briefly explain why you feel this answer should be reported.
Please briefly explain why you feel this user should be reported.
make the conversion in the view – IMHO this is not against MVC.
If you want to go hardcore with your design create a new class/struct “Gender” with static creation methods/properties “Male”, “Female”, overload the ToString accordingly and cast-operators to bool or a constructor with bool and a ToBool function.